Harold Garcia is the third coach on the staff...The Kissimmee, Fla. resident originally signed by the Phillies as an amateur free agent in 2005, he is in his first year on the organization’s player development staff..Played eight of his nine minor league seasons with the Phillies. In 2010, with Clearwater (A), broke a 59-year-old record by hitting safely in 37 consecutive games.
